
I had a discussion with Mr. Bolosh (Minister of Finance No. He listened to us, but the echoes are the same. Everyone complains, all industries come and talk about their moves and try to get their benefits, while the big budget suffers dramatically and they are in a position of choice between two ashes, said Celin Ile, honorary president of the Federation of Hotel Industry from Romania – FIHR.
Two evils:
1. To be able to implement the budget only in the conditions of this deficit, which blocks the sources of its financing from the PNRR and the European Commission.
2. Adjust taxation in certain sectors, such as tourism, IT, construction, agriculture, excise taxes. “It’s that long list you’ve all seen.”
“I wouldn’t want it to be a battle where the sectors that are louder, more influential, win and don’t win arguments,” Ile told the CLCC conference.
- “We listen to the opinion of the government, which found itself in a difficult situation, but when we signaled over time that this policy would be difficult, we were not heard.”
They told Marcel Bolosh that tourism is an industry at risk in terms of tax evasion.
“Any increase in taxation will bring even greater danger and must be taken into account. There is a risk that a significant part of the industry will migrate not to the black, but to the gray for sure,” Kelin Ile also noted.
- “We are convinced that the increase in taxation will be reflected in prices. The question is how much more the consumer can take.”
“Can we pay off another tax increase because of the prices we’re charging? A possible increase in tariffs will limit consumption. How much is hard to say. I presented these arguments to the Minister of Finance. We don’t know what the consequences will be. This is still being discussed in the Coalition,” the honorary president of the Hotel Industry Federation from Romania also noted.
